Associated Builders and Contractors/Construction Education Trust has been instructing apprentices in the skilled trades for twenty years. Our mission is to train tomorrows workforce to be skilled, motivated, and safety conscience. Trained apprentices become professional craft persons.
The Apprenticeship Program offers four years of intense and trades specific training in the following crafts: Electrical, Carpentry, Plumbing, Sheet Metal and HVAC (Heating and Cooling).
Accreditation with the National Center for Construction Education and Research (NCCER) provides world-class craft training materials and opportunities for leadership and growth. In addition, the NCCER National Registry maintains trainees’ academic records, provides transcripts, and certificates that document their training accomplishments. The NCCER also provides skills assessments, construction management academics, and safety programs.
Associated Builders & Contractors / Construction Education Trust is proud to list the following credentials which lend credence to the apprentice program:
● Licensed with State of Michigan as a non-profit education program.
● Registered with the Department of Labor / Bureau of Apprenticeship Training
● Registered with the Center for Construction Education Research (NCCER)
● Approved training program for Veterans Administration (VA)
● Approved training program for Michigan Merit Scholarship Awards
● Approved training program for Michigan Works
● Articulation agreement with Oakland Community College |
